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Alder Spittlebug | Medog Odorous Frog |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Arthropoda (Arthropods)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Insecta (Insects) | Amphibia (Amphibians) |
| Order | Hemiptera (Hemiptera) | Anura (Frogs & Toads) |
| Family | Aphrophoridae | Ranidae |
| Genus | Aphrophora | Odorrana |
| Species | Aphrophora alni | Odorrana zhaoi |
